Understanding Card Values in Platform Games
In games that use standard playing cards, such as Run Fast, knowing the hierarchy of cards is vital. Cards are generally ranked from low (3) to high (2), with special conditions sometimes applying based on game variation. Establishing a strong foundational understanding of card values allows players to make educated decisions swiftly, which is imperative given the short time frames in fast-paced games.

Recognizing Signs of Problem Gambling
Being aware of the signs of problem gambling is crucial to maintaining a healthy gambling habit. Signs could include feeling anxious about finances, gambling with money that should be allocated for necessities, or losing track of time. Players should never hesitate to seek help if they feel their gaming habits are overly risky.
